top of page
90s theme grid background
Writer's pictureGunashree RS

Guide to Mac Wineskin: Windows Apps on Mac

Updated: Sep 22

Introduction

Mac Wineskin is an incredible tool that allows Mac users to run Windows applications natively on their macOS devices. Whether you're a gamer wanting to play your favorite PC games or a professional needing specific Windows software, Mac Wineskin can bridge the gap. This guide delves into the depths of Mac Wineskin, providing detailed instructions, tips, and best practices to help you make the most of this versatile tool. From installation to troubleshooting, we cover everything you need to know about Mac Wineskin.



What is Mac Wineskin ?


Mac wineskin

Definition and Overview

Mac Wineskin is a software tool designed to port Windows applications to macOS. It works by creating a wrapper around the Windows software, allowing it to run on Mac as if it were a native application. This wrapper encapsulates the Windows executable and any necessary libraries, providing a seamless experience for the user.


Core Technology

At its core, Mac Wineskin utilizes Wine, an open-source compatibility layer that re-implements the Win32 API for Unix-based systems. Wine stands for "Wine Is Not an Emulator," and it allows Windows applications to run on non-Windows operating systems by translating Windows API calls into POSIX calls.


Key Features

  • Free to Use: Mac Wineskin is free software, making it accessible to everyone.

  • Portability: Create wrappers that can be shared with others.

  • Versatility: Suitable for both gaming and non-gaming applications.

  • No Need for Windows OS: Runs Windows applications without requiring a Windows operating system installation.



How to Install Mac Wineskin


Downloading Wineskin

To get started, you need to download the Wineskin Winery application. This tool manages different versions of the Wineskin engine and allows you to create new wrappers.

  1. Visit the official Wineskin Winery download page.

  2. Download the latest version of Wineskin Winery.

  3. Open the downloaded .zip file and move the Wineskin Winery app to your Applications folder.


Setting Up Wineskin Winery

Once you have Wineskin Winery installed, follow these steps to set it up:

  1. Open Wineskin Winery from your Applications folder.

  2. Click on the "+" button to add a new engine.

  3. Select the latest available engine and click "Download and Install."

  4. Once the engine is installed, click "Create New Blank Wrapper."

  5. Name your wrapper (e.g., "My Windows App") and click "OK."


Creating a Wrapper

Creating a wrapper involves setting up a virtual Windows environment within the wrapper:

  1. After naming your wrapper, wait for the process to complete.

  2. Click "View Wrapper in Finder" when prompted.

  3. Navigate to the wrapper you just created and double-click to open it.

  4. Click "Install Software" and follow the prompts to install your Windows application.



Running Windows Applications on Mac Wineskin


Installing Software

To install a Windows application within your Wineskin wrapper:

  1. Open the wrapper and select "Install Software."

  2. Choose the setup executable for your Windows application.

  3. Follow the installation prompts just as you would on a Windows machine.

  4. Once the installation is complete, configure the executable to run when you open the wrapper.


Configuring Screen Options

For optimal performance, you may need to configure screen options:

  1. Open the wrapper and click "Advanced."

  2. Go to the "Screen Options" tab.

  3. Adjust settings such as resolution and Direct3D options to match your preferences.


Running the Application

To run your Windows application:

  1. Double-click the wrapper in Finder.

  2. The application should open and run as if it were a native Mac application.



Common Issues and Troubleshooting


Application Crashes on Launch

If your application crashes on launch, try these steps:

  1. Open the wrapper and click "Advanced."

  2. Go to the "Tools" tab and click "Test Run."

  3. Check the logs for any errors and adjust settings accordingly.

  4. Ensure that your macOS is up to date.


Graphics and Performance Issues

For graphics or performance issues:

  1. Go to "Advanced" -> "Tools" -> "Set Screen Options."

  2. Uncheck "Auto Detect GPU for Direct3D."

  3. Experiment with different Direct3D settings to improve performance.


Audio Problems

If you encounter audio problems:

  1. Go to "Advanced" -> "Tools" -> "Change Engine Used."

  2. Select a different engine version that might be more compatible with your application.



Advanced Features of Mac Wineskin


Using Custom Engines

Custom engines can provide additional features or improved compatibility:

  1. Download the custom engine you need.

  2. Place it in the ~/Library/Application Support/Wineskin/Engines directory.

  3. Select the custom engine when creating a new wrapper.


Utilizing WineskinX11

WineskinX11 is a custom version of X11 used by Wineskin. You can also use XQuartz if you prefer:

  1. Install XQuartz from the official website.

  2. Configure your wrapper to use XQuartz instead of WineskinX11.


Integrating with Crossover

Crossover, a product by CodeWeavers, uses a similar technology to Wineskin and can sometimes offer better compatibility:

  1. Download the Crossover engine build.

  2. Place it in the appropriate directory and select it when creating a new wrapper.



Best Practices for Using Mac Wineskin


Regular Updates

Keep Wineskin and its engines updated to ensure the best compatibility and performance.


Documentation

Document the steps you take to create and configure wrappers, especially if you plan to share them with others.


Community Support

Leverage the Wineskin community for support and advice. Many users share their experiences and solutions on forums and social media.


Backup Wrappers

Always backup your wrappers before making significant changes or updates to avoid losing your configurations.



Examples of Using Mac Wineskin


Gaming with Wineskin

Many gamers use Wineskin to play Windows-exclusive games on their Mac:

  1. Create a wrapper for your game.

  2. Install the game and configure the necessary settings.

  3. Enjoy gaming without the need for a Windows PC.


Running Productivity Software

Wineskin is also useful for running productivity software:

  1. Create a wrapper for applications like Microsoft Office or other business tools.

  2. Install and configure them as needed.

  3. Increase productivity without switching to a Windows machine.



Tips for Enhancing Performance


Optimizing Settings

Experiment with different settings to find the best configuration for your application. Pay attention to graphics, screen resolution, and Direct3D options.


Using SSDs

Install your wrappers on an SSD to improve loading times and overall performance.


Memory Allocation

Ensure your Mac has enough RAM to handle the additional load of running Windows applications. Close unnecessary applications to free up memory.



Case Study: Running Popular Games on Mac Wineskin


The Elder Scrolls V: Skyrim

Running a game like Skyrim on a Mac using Wineskin requires careful configuration:

  1. Create a new wrapper named "Skyrim."

  2. Install the game using the setup executable.

  3. Configure the graphics settings to match your Mac's capabilities.

  4. Test run the game and adjust settings as necessary to achieve smooth performance.


League of Legends

League of Legends is another popular game that can run on Mac through Wineskin:

  1. Create a wrapper named "League of Legends."

  2. Download and install the game from the official website.

  3. Optimize the screen settings and network configurations to ensure low latency.

  4. Enjoy playing with minimal performance issues.



User Experiences and Testimonials


Gamer's Perspective

Many gamers have successfully used Mac Wineskin to run their favorite Windows games on Mac. Here are some testimonials:

  • "Using Wineskin, I was able to play games like Skyrim and Fallout on my Mac without any significant issues. The performance was impressive!"

  • "Wineskin allowed me to enjoy PC gaming on my Mac. The community support was fantastic in helping me set everything up."


Professional Use

Professionals needing specific Windows software for their work have also benefited from Mac Wineskin:

  • "As a graphic designer, I needed certain Windows-only applications. Wineskin made it possible to run them seamlessly on my Mac."

  • "Wineskin saved me from having to switch between operating systems. Now I can run all my required software on my Mac."



Future of Mac Wineskin


Upcoming Features

The development community behind Wineskin continues to innovate and improve the tool. Some expected future features include:

  • Enhanced Compatibility: Better support for newer Windows applications and games.

  • Improved Performance: Optimizations for faster and smoother application running.

  • User-Friendly Interfaces: Simplified setup processes and more intuitive configuration options.


Community Contributions

The Wineskin community plays a crucial role in its development. Contributions from users help identify bugs, suggest new features, and provide support for fellow users.



Conclusion

Mac Wineskin is a powerful tool that opens up a world of possibilities for Mac users, allowing them to run Windows applications natively without the need for a separate Windows OS installation. Whether you're a gamer, a professional, or just someone who needs a specific Windows application, Wineskin provides a flexible and efficient solution. By following the steps and best practices outlined in this guide, you can make the most of Mac Wineskin and enhance your computing experience.


Key Takeaways

  • Mac Wineskin enables Mac users to run Windows applications natively.

  • Wineskin is free and uses Wine to translate Windows API calls into POSIX calls.

  • Installation involves downloading Wineskin Winery, setting up engines, and creating wrappers.

  • Configuration of screen options and graphics settings is crucial for optimal performance.

  • Advanced features include using custom engines and WineskinX11 or XQuartz for better compatibility.

  • Best practices involve regular updates, documentation, and community support.

  • Applications range from gaming to productivity software, enhancing versatility.

  • Troubleshooting common issues can improve user experience and performance.



FAQs


What is Mac Wineskin?

Mac Wineskin is a tool that allows Mac users to run Windows applications by creating wrappers that encapsulate the Windows software, making it function like a native Mac application.


Is Wineskin free to use?

Yes, Wineskin is free to use. It is open-source software that provides a cost-effective solution for running Windows applications on macOS.


How do I install Wineskin on my Mac?

Download the Wineskin Winery app, install it, and then create new wrappers for your Windows applications. Detailed instructions are provided in the guide above.


Can I run any Windows application using Wineskin?

While Wineskin supports many Windows applications, compatibility can vary. Some applications may require specific configurations or custom engines to work correctly.


What should I do if my application crashes on launch?

Check the logs in the "Advanced" -> "Tools" -> "Test Run" section for errors, and ensure your macOS is up to date. Adjust settings as needed to resolve the issue.


Can I use Wineskin for gaming?

Yes, many users successfully run Windows-exclusive games on their Mac using Wineskin. Proper configuration and settings optimization can enhance gaming performance.


What is WineskinX11?

WineskinX11 is a custom version of X11 used by Wineskin to run Windows applications. Users can also opt to use XQuartz if preferred.


How can I improve the performance of applications running on Wineskin?

Optimize settings, install wrappers on SSDs, and ensure adequate RAM is available. Experiment with different configurations to achieve the best performance.


Article Sources


Comments


bottom of page